Goals Are written as broad statements of purpose or intent Answer the question, “What do I want my learners to be able to do at the end of my course?” Serve as criteria for selection of curricular components (assessments & learning strategies) Clearly communicate what the learning experience addresses Serve as benchmarks against which courses can be evaluated Can be considered “broad” educational objectives
  • 7. Goals Differ from Learning Objectives Goals Learning Objectives  Can use verbs such as “understand,” “know” or “appreciate”  Often begin with a purpose statement,  The purpose of this course is ….  Use strong, action-oriented verbs in one of three domains of learning:  Cognitive (knowledge)  Psychomotor (skill and behavior)  Affective (attitudinal)  Can also be related to process or desired outcomes of the learning experience
  • 8. A well-written objective answers the question: Who will do how much (or how well) of what by when? Hint: When writing your objective, begin with “By when”
  • 9. Example of a learning objective for our course  At the end of this course (condition), learners will be able to design a learning experience (desired behavior) that successfully integrates goals and objectives, learning strategies, and assessments according to the rubric provided. (performance standard) See if you can identify  Who will do how much (or how well) of what by when

Categories of Objectives Learner (or Learning) Objectives - KSAs • What individuals will learn within the instructional setting Process Objectives • What will be accomplished by your learning experience (outputs) Outcome Objectives • Indicators of impact, such as health, healthcare, and patient outcomes
